Arsenic determination in rice by hydride generation atomic absorption method
Contamination of soils and water environments with heavy metals is a serious and expanding problem. The entry of heavy metals through human activities has caused the pollution of many soils. Also, contamination of rice with heavy metals and its entry into the food chain can have harmful effects on human health. Arsenic species need to be carefully monitored in food due to their toxicity. In this article, the importance of measuring arsenic in rice by selective hydride production atomic absorption spectrometry, as well as the types of nuisances and methods to solve them, are discussed. The atomic absorption spectrometer must be equipped with an air-acetylene torch, a hydride vapor generator, a quartz absorption tube, an arsenic hollow cathode lamp, suitable for measuring at a wavelength of 193.7 nm.
